Building a Bridge with Part-Time Leadership

Convincing leadership to use a fractional CMO gets much easier when you focus on agility. A fractional leader provides high-level guidance without demanding a massive, full-time executive salary. They step in, assess the current landscape, and implement necessary changes immediately.

Fractional CMOs and executive alignment are a perfect match for rapidly growing businesses. These leaders act as a trusted bridge between the board of directors and external creative teams. They ensure that all marketing activities directly support the main business objectives.

This part-time expertise allows your company to remain highly competitive in shifting markets. They bring fresh perspectives that internal teams often overlook completely. By hiring a fractional leader, your business gains elite strategic oversight and massive financial flexibility.

Empowering External Partnerships

Once leadership is aligned, the focus naturally shifts to tactical execution. Understanding what CMOs need to know about full-service agencies is vital for long-term success. Agencies are excellent at creating content, but they desperately need clear strategic direction.

A fractional executive manages these complex agency relationships flawlessly. They provide the necessary oversight to keep external teams on track and on budget. Earning executive buy-in for outsourcing requires proving that external agencies can be controlled effectively. A part-time chief marketing officer provides that exact layer of accountable, reliable management.
